Definition

noun

  1. 1.A bottle of wine containing 1.5 liters of fluid, double the volume of a standard bottle.
  2. 2.A powerful firearm cartridge, often derived from a shorter, less powerful cartridge calibre that uses the same bullet.
  3. 3.A handgun that fires a cartridge of this calibre; chiefly a revolver, but rarely an autoloader firing an unusually powerful calibre.
